And lest we forget, Bruce Timm, the man responsible for the classic retro yet edgy look of the animated series. Quote: Can't say I have. What is it about? It may be a bit artsy for your tastes, I dunno. It's basically an exploration of Batman's psychosis. Joker takes control of Arkham and hold people hostage and Batman has to enter the madhouse, all while coming to terms with his own craziness. One of my favorite scenes is when, once Batman finally comes face to face with the main menagerie of villains, they all want to take off his mask to see his "real face." Joker doesn't let them, saying snidely that Batman IS his real face. It was just such a perfect picture of how much Joker understands Batman and how sad that really is.
